The Challenge: Microbial Control in Food Processing Environments
Food processing facilities face stringent hygiene requirements. Throughout production — from raw material handling to packaging — airborne bacteria, mold spores, and yeast can settle on food products, equipment surfaces, and packaging materials. This affects shelf life and creates food safety risks.
Traditional disinfection methods have limitations. Manual chemical spraying leaves dead zones and inconsistent coverage. UV lamps cannot treat large areas effectively and require frequent maintenance. Chemical residues also pose contamination risks.
The customer operates a standardized Class 10,000 food processing workshop with clear microbial control targets. After comparing multiple disinfection approaches, they selected FEILI's air-source ozone solution. The key requirement: stable ozone concentration of 10 ppm to ensure effective microbial inactivation.

The Solution: 500g/h Air-Source Ozone Generator with Overhead Distribution
FEILI designed a centralized disinfection system featuring a 500g/h air-source ozone generator with overhead piping distribution. The system was sized based on the workshop's volume, ventilation conditions, and production schedule.
The 500g/h unit is installed in a dedicated equipment room outside the production area. Its 304 stainless steel housing ensures durability in humid environments. The intelligent touchscreen display shows real-time operating status, ozone output concentration, and runtime parameters. Programmable timer and concentration adjustment allow flexible scheduling around production shifts.
Overhead distribution piping extends from the equipment room into the workshop, with evenly spaced outlets delivering ozone gas throughout the space. This design ensures uniform coverage — including areas beneath production equipment and ventilation dead zones that traditional cleaning methods cannot reach.
Validation Results: 10 ppm in 60 Minutes
After installation, FEILI technicians conducted continuous concentration monitoring using calibrated ozone detectors. Test results confirmed that ozone concentration stabilized at 10 ppm across all workshop zones within 60 minutes of operation — fully meeting the customer's disinfection specification.

Ozone Disinfection: Cleaner, Safer, More Cost-Effective
Ozone is a highly effective disinfectant. Its strong oxidizing properties destroy bacterial cell membranes and inactivate viruses and mold spores. After completing the disinfection cycle, ozone decomposes naturally to oxygen within minutes — leaving no chemical residues and creating no secondary pollution.
The air-source design eliminates the need for separate oxygen generation equipment, simplifying installation and reducing capital costs. This makes it particularly suitable for centralized disinfection in food processing workshops.
